What are the rules for string size comparisons?
For example: "Ten", "10a", "a", "abc" How do they sort in ascending descending order?? Ask for rules!!


Reply to discussion (solution)

As far as I know, the rule of comparison between them is: The first letter of the ASCLL size comparison if the same is compared to the second one.

The string size is sorted according to the ASCII of the first character.

As far as I know, the rule of comparison between them is: The first letter of the ASCLL size comparison if the same is compared to the second one.
"Ten", "10a" How do these two compare?

Var_dump (STRNATCMP ("Ten", "10a"));

Int (-1)

means "10a" < "ten"
